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in Wilton Homes
- Unsealed track mounts corrode in tule fog. North-facing doors on low-lying parcels near the Cosumnes River basin see track mounts rust through within two fog seasons. We spec galvanized or stainless mounting hardware and recommend annual inspection before corrosion causes sag and binding.
- Underspec’d springs fail in summer heat. Outdated torsion springs on oversized ranch doors snap when temperatures exceed 105°F — especially when the original installer used standard residential cycle-life springs on a door that opens four or five times daily for equipment access. We calculate actual cycle demand and install high-cycle springs accordingly.
- Hay and dust destroy photo-eye sensors. Rural dust and hay debris from adjacent horse properties clog roller bearings and photo-eye sensors at a much higher rate than in suburban settings. On new installations, we often offset sensors or add protective covers to reduce false obstruction triggers.
- Non-standard framing on metal shop buildings. Many Wilton properties have pole-barn or red-iron shop structures without the dimensional lumber headers found in residential construction. We engineer custom jamb and header solutions rather than forcing standard residential hardware onto incompatible framing.

We recommend a minimum 20-PSF wind-load rating for most Wilton properties, with 25-PSF or higher for exposed acreage sites and oversized doors on detached workshops. Wilton’s flat valley terrain and lack of windbreaks create higher effective wind pressure than sheltered suburban lots. We’ll assess your specific exposure and recommend accordingly during your free estimate.

Twice yearly — before fog season in October and before summer heat in May. Local techs often find seasonal cleanout and bearing repacking is needed twice yearly on any garage used for equipment or livestock supply storage. The combination of fine dust, hay chaff, and moisture creates abrasive paste in roller bearings and false triggers in photo-eye sensors. Preventive service costs far less than emergency replacement of corroded hardware.
Insulated steel with galvanized hardware is the practical choice for Wilton. It resists the corrosion that destroys unprotected steel in tule fog, reflects summer heat rather than warping like wood, and maintains interior temperature stability for equipment and supply storage.
